How Does It Work?
Stewart's has once again partnered with the American Red Cross for the 11th annual "Give a Pint, Get a Pint" campaign. Anyone who donates blood at a participating Red Cross blood drive in one of the 26 counties served by Stewart's will receive a coupon for a free pint of Stewart's ice cream or gelato.
The sweet reward is just a bonus. Since the campaign launched in 2016, it has helped collect more than 104,000 blood donations from nearly 61,000 donors.
Why Does This Campaign Start Now?
The program is especially important during the summer months. While donations often slow down, the need for blood never does.
Red Cross officials say hospitals depend on blood donations every day to help accident victims, cancer patients, surgery patients, and others. Across the country, someone needs blood every two seconds.
